Question:
Hi There- I have a 1998 Lexus LX470 with no tow package. Im trying to determine what parts I need for setting up a brake controller. Right now everything is stock aside from an aftermarket Curt hitch and 7 pin wiring connection plug for connecting my R-Pod travel trailer. These parts are currently in place and working. A brake controller unit came with the R-Pod, but Im not sure what cables I need to interface it with my 7-pin connection in the rear. What do you recommend? Thank you!
asked by: Jonathan C
Helpful Expert Reply:
Since you have a brake controller already and a functioning 7-way all you need to wire the brake controller to the vehicle and 7-way is the install kit part # 5506. This comes with everything needed for powering the brake controller but you will also need 10 gauge wire like part # 10-1-1 (sold by the foot to connect the wire to the 7-way.
